Add the exisiting %pid based readmirror policy as an attribute /sys/fs/btrfs/UUID/readmirror/by_pid When read, this returns 0 or 1. 1 indicates the currently active policy. When written with 1, it sets pid as the current active policy and when written 0 it resets to the default readmirror policy which as of now is pid as well. For any other value it returns EINVAL.
